What you need to know
- Fossil Group has pushed the Wear OS 3 update to the Skagen Falster Gen 6.
- The update gets rid of the Google Assistant, although some users noted fewer watch faces available.
- Users should factory reset the watch and set it up using the Skagen Smartwatches app.
Fossil Gen 6 owners have been enjoying the Wear OS 3 updates quite a bit for some time now. But after months of feeling left out of the fun, Skagen smartwatch owners are finally getting an update on their devices.
A Reddit user pointed out a new update that appeared to be rolling out widely on Thursday. We were also able to update some Skagen Falster Gen 6 units.

Upon receiving an update notification, the user will be instructed on how to update the watch. This notification alerts the user that the smartwatch needs to be factory reset. This means you will lose all your data and have to set everything up from scratch.
Additionally, Skagen Falster Gen 6 owners will need to download the new Skagen Smartwatches app to set up and pair the device. This is virtually identical to his Fossil Smartwatches app used on the Fossil Gen 6 Wellness Edition and other of his Fossil smartwatches.
Note that installing Wear OS 3 is optional, but Google Assistant no longer exists as it does not support Wear OS 3 devices with Snapdragon chipsets. Instead, you’ll be prompted to set up Alexa as an alternative.

Wear OS 3 on the Skagen Falster Gen 6 is more or less a “stock” experience, similar to the Pixel Watch, but without Pixel-specific features. However, the Fossil Wellness app still exists and is compatible with iOS (although Google Wallet is not supported on iOS devices). The update also includes his December patch, which rolled out to Fossil smartwatches last month and brought many improvements.
Reddit users point out that there are far fewer watch faces available for this device, with only eight options. This compares to 12 available in the Fossil Gen 6 Wellness Edition.
If you don’t receive an update notification, you can update your watch by going to: Settings > System > About > System UpdateIf your watch doesn’t get the update right away, you can tap and hold the update page for a few seconds until an update prompt appears. This is a trick that tends to work on many Wear OS watches.
